The first thing you need to do before rooting your Z828 is to backup all your data. Rooting involves unlocking the bootloader, which wipes all the data on your device. Therefore, it is essential to create a backup of your contacts, messages, photos, videos, and other important files. You can use the built-in backup feature or third-party apps like Google Drive or Dropbox to store your data in the cloud.
After backing up your data, you need to enable developer options and USB debugging on your Z828. Developer options provide access to advanced settings and features that are not visible in the standard settings menu. To enable developer options, go to Settings > About phone > Build number and tap it seven times. Then, go back to the main settings menu, and you will see a new option called Developer options. Tap on it and turn on USB debugging.
The next step is to unlock the bootloader of your Z828. The bootloader is a program that runs before the operating system and verifies the integrity of the firmware. By unlocking the bootloader, you can install custom firmware and recovery, which are necessary for rooting. To unlock the bootloader, you need to go to the official ZTE website, create an account, and submit a bootloader unlock request. After receiving the unlock code, you can use ADB and Fastboot commands to unlock the bootloader.
Once you have unlocked the bootloader, you can install a custom recovery like TWRP on your Z828. A custom recovery is a replacement for the stock recovery that provides additional features like backup and restore, flashing custom ROMs and kernels, and wiping cache and data. To install TWRP, you need to download the recovery image and flash it using Fastboot commands. Make sure to follow the instructions carefully and double-check the commands before executing them.
After installing TWRP, you can now root your Z828 by flashing SuperSU or Magisk. These are third-party apps that grant root access to your device and allow you to modify system files and settings. SuperSU is the traditional way of rooting, while Magisk is a newer method that offers more flexibility and compatibility with systemless modules. To flash SuperSU or Magisk, you need to download the zip file and transfer it to your device's internal storage. Then, boot into TWRP, select the Install option, and choose the SuperSU or Magisk zip file. Swipe to confirm the installation, and wait for the process to finish.

What is rooting?
Rooting an Android device means gaining access to the root of the file system. It allows you to access system files and settings that are not available to regular users. This gives you more control over your device and allows you to customize it to your liking.
Is rooting safe?
Rooting can be risky if done incorrectly. It can void your device's warranty and potentially brick your phone if you make a mistake. However, if done properly, rooting can be safe and beneficial for your device.
